Washington Mardi Gras, celebrated with Kim Lay and my stepmom, Carol, always falls two weeks ahead of New Orleans' own. DC brings in chefs, musicians, and even king cakes shipped in from Louisiana — worth catching if you're ever in town this time of year. Festivities close out Saturday night with a live parade inside the Hilton ballroom.
